blutch wrote:
The frustrating thing was having to go back and forth to the keyboard to select brush size, etc. Do the more expensive ones make it possible to do those key commands on the pad? Also, I\'m curious as to what remapping to 1/4 the size accomplishes when using LR or PS to retouch. Mshi - could you elaborate on that please?

Thanks to all.

B


No, you don\'t have to go back to keyboard to choose different brush size. You can program those two buttons on the pen for brush size, for example, the lower one for smaller size by mapping it to [ key, and the upper one to bigger size to ] key. I prefer smaller work area for faster workflow. It\'s a person thing. You can do so with the included Wacom software.
